I'm relatively new to mini painting, and so far I've used relatively smooth colors for my 15mm figures, such as my bandits.

However, I'd like to try my hand at painting camouflage patterns and give my 15mm troops urban or forest camouflage uniforms.

Help would be appreciated; if there is an online tutorial about doing this, I'll be grateful if someone would point me to it :)

There is no actual wrong way of painting camo (even flourscent camo can be found these days... don't ask, I don't get it either).

My personal methods are as follows, for jungle/greenery camo I start with a dark matt green, and I paint stripes of tan, beige, black and sometimes a lighter green, just make sure that the srtipes are not all in the same direction, have a few overlapping, generally try to make them look less uniform.

For desert camo, I start with a tan or light brown and dab dark grey, dark brown and a touch (very very little) black, use spots for desert.

For urban camo I start with a dark grey and use irregular block shapes of black, white and light grey, again try to keep them from being too uniform, but be usre to have sharp edges to the shapes, unlike the others that need irregular edges.

Well thats how I do it.
